This role will see you keeping non‑production environments fast, reliable, and ready for change. The Environments & Release Engineer owns the health and consistency of lower environments, keeping them aligned with Production so teams can build, test, and release with confidence using realistic data.

The role involves spinning environments up when needed, keeping them running smoothly, and retiring them cleanly helping reduce defects and make delivery more predictable. Working closely with engineers, testers, and architects, this role takes real ownership, spots issues early, and communicates clearly when it matters.

What you’ll be doing?

·        Build and maintain robust, secure, and scalable platforms in a hybrid cloud environment using technologies such as Kubernetes, Docker, Terraform, and Helm.

·        Keep non‑production environments baselined and aligned with Production, including regular code and data copybacks.

·        Manage environment configuration, variables, and secrets in line with security and compliance standards.

·        Support sprint and release cycles by ensuring lower environments are up to date, available, and fit for purpose ahead of testing and release activities.

·        Monitor environment health, reliability, and performance, proactively identifying and resolving issues before they impact delivery.

·        Create, configure, and, where appropriate, decommission environments to support projects, test phases, and experiments.

·        Drive automation and tooling to reduce manual effort across Azure environments and CI/CD pipelines.

·        Partner with Development, Architecture, and Infrastructure teams to align initiatives and promote standardisation and best practice.

·        Create and maintain clear documentation, runbooks, and environment diagrams to support reliable, repeatable operations.

·        Contribute to continuous improvement of route‑to‑live processes, including feedback into release management, testing, and observability.


Who are we looking for?

·        Strong scripting capability in at least one language (e.g. Bash, Python, or PowerShell).

·        Strong troubleshooting skills with a logical, automation‑first mindset.

·        Familiarity with CI/CD tooling (ideally Azure DevOps) and modern Git‑based branching strategies.

·        Clear, concise written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to produce high‑quality documentation.

·        Ability to manage multiple environments and competing priorities in a structured and organised way.

·        High‑level understanding of Kubernetes concepts such as pods, deployments, services, and ingress.
